Aix-en-Provence weather in July

In July, Aix-en-Provence sees average daytime highs of 29°C and overnight lows near 18°C, with 19 mm of rain across 3.3 wet days and about 14.9 hours of daylight. It is the 1st-warmest and 12th-wettest month of the year here.

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 29°C through the month.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 74% of the time in July,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 15 h 12 min at the start of July to 14 h 30 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, July is Aix-en-Provence's 1st-clearest and 7th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Aix-en-Provence's year-round climate.

Temperature in July

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 29°C through the month.

A typical July day in Aix-en-Provence reaches about 29°C in the afternoon and slips back to 18°C overnight — a 11°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 26°C and 32°C. Set against its neighbours, July runs about 3°C warmer than June and on par with August.

Sea temperature near Aix-en-Provence in July

The nearest coast averages about 21°C in July — the other half of the beach question. The full-year curve and swim-comfort zones are below.

The sea at the nearest coast (about 18 km away) is warmest in August at about 22°C and coldest in February near 13°C.

It's comfortable for a long swim from Jun 29 to Sep 30 — about 3.1 months when the water holds above 20°C.

UV index in Aix-en-Provence in July

LowModerateHighVery highExtreme

Clear-sky midday UV in July peaks around 9 (very high — sun protection essential). The full-year curve, shaded by WHO exposure level, is below.

Under clear skies, the midday UV index in Aix-en-Provence peaks around July 16 at about 9 (very high) — sunscreen, a hat and midday shade are essential. It bottoms out near December 22 at about 1 (low).

The index reaches 3 or more — the level where the WHO recommends sun protection — in 8 months of the year.

Location & terrain

Where is Aix-en-Provence?

Aix-en-Provence sits at 43.5°N, 5.4°E, 205 m above sea level, in France. The nearest listed city is Gardanne, 8.0 km away.

Topography around Aix-en-Provence

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Aix-en-Provence.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Aix-en-Provence has signific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 250 m around an average of 222 m above sea level; within 16 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 953 m; within 80 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,897 m.

The land around Aix-en-Provence is covered by trees (50%) and artificial surfaces (38%) within 3 km, trees (58%) within 16 km, and trees (49%) and water (25%) within 80 km.
